Description
Tropical Storm Francine is still making a beeline for a Louisiana landfall midday Wednesday as possibly a category-2 hurricane.
Overnight Francine did not strengthen thanks to dry air. The storm is forecast to restart intensifying Tuesday and the official forecast has the storm as a hurricane today and Wednesday. Landfall is still expected in South Louisiana Wednesday afternoon as a hurricane with winds as high as 100 mph. Luckily wind shear will increase on Wednesday, so hopefully we see the storms weakening upon approach to land, but you should prepare for a Cat 2 hurricane in coastal areas.
